Modi, Putin hold talks in New Delhi on trade, defence

  •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i met with Russian President Vladimir Putin and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ian in New Delhi ahead of the BRICS summit, focusing on trade, defence, and regional security amid global conflicts and economic challenges.
  • The BRICS summit, attended by leaders including Xi Jinping, Vladimir Putin, and Masoud Pezeshkian, is set to address wars in the Middle East and Ukraine as well as global trade and energy issues.
  • Iran's inclusion in BRICS brings tensions over the Middle East conflict into the group, complicating cohesion among members with differing stances on ongoing wars.
  • India aims to strengthen strategic ties with Russia through cooperation in critical minerals and defence technology while promoting BRICS as a platform for dialogue and a more representative global order.

Narendra Modi opened this Friday the BRICS summit in India with a meeting with Vladimir Putin. The two leaders arrived together in the same car, a Russian-made armored limousine Aurus Senat, to the Bharat Mandapam convention room in New Delhi, where their meeting was planned.
